The Evolution of Search

The way in which society accesses and explores information has dramatically changed with the evolution of technology. From the days of the Yellow Pages, card catalogues and manual searches in libraries, we have progressed into a digital era, where the internet and search engines like Google have become our gateway to a wide world of knowledge. With the arival of online search technology and the evolution of society, search engines began to emerge and develop with the aim to structure and index the endless amount of online information.

Initial search engines like Bing and Yahoo paved the way to a digital world, but as we all know, it was the establishment of Google that really revolutionalised the the online landscape. Google’s innovative page ranking algorithm, assessing the authenticity of web pages according to elements of content and extternal links, brought never before seen authority and efficiency to search engine results.

With the advancement of technology, the nature of search developed. The domination of smartphone devices brought us with on-the-go searching capabilities, while social media platforms introduced personalised algorithms for search and sicovery. The birth of both visual and voice search enabled hands-free convenience and enhanced a user’s ability to conveniently skim the internet for digital images.

The recent Artificial Intelligence (AI) breakthrough has forced search engines to become smarter and further develop to understand user intent and context through semantic search. Moving forward, it is clear to predict that advancements in augmented reality experiences, enhanced voice interactions and continued integration of AI are in the near future. The evolution of search has truly empowered society’s ability to navigate more information than ever before, developing our ability to access knowledge in today’s world.

Popular Types of Search

In today’s digital age, search engines have become essential tools for navigating the vast landscape of information on the internet with 97% of searches for local businesses occuring online.

With 90% of internet searches using Google, the leading search engine, the platform offers a multitude of search options to cater to different user preferences and needs. Among the popular types of searches are:

Image Search

Allows users to search for images online using keywords or phrases.

Video Search

Allows users to search for videos online using keywords or phrases.

Voice Search

Allows users to search hands-free, using voice commands.

Local Search

Allows users to search for businesses and services near their location.

Faceted Search

Allows users to refine their searches by selecting specific categories and parameters.

These diverse search methods have revolutionised the way we seek and consume information, providing us with instant access to a world of knowledge, entertainment, and local resources.

Search engine optimisation (SEO) is one of the most effective ways to improve your website’s visibility and increase its ranking in search engine results. SEO involves optimising your website and its content to make it easier for search engines to understand what your website is about and how it is relevant to a user’s query.

It also involves optimising your website’s technical aspects, such as ensuring its pages load quickly and are mobile-friendly. By taking the time to properly optimise your website, you can ensure that your website appears in the top search results for relevant queries, increasing your website’s traffic and improving your online presence.
